The ZIP holds roughly 2,326 housing units. The poverty rate is 10.0%. Households earn a median $55,019 — below the roughly $78,000 national figure. The demographic-stress sub-score lands at 30/100. About 10% have a four-year degree. The typical home is worth about $234,000 (3.4× income, relatively affordable). Owners hold 67% of homes, renters 33%. Population is roughly 4,491 with a median age of 47. Around 28% of renters are cost-burdened. The vacancy rate is 8.8%.
